Indian Premier League franchise Rajasthan Royals have appointed Sri Lankan legend Kumar Sangakkara as the Director of Cricket of their team. Apart from overseeing the team’s overgrowth, he has been given the task of cricketing infrastructure growth and scouting the future talents for the team.
"To oversee the cricket strategy of a franchise in the leading cricket competition in the world, as well as building the development programs and cricketing infrastructure that will provide the future foundation of the IPL team's on-field success, is an opportunity that really motivated me," Sangakarra, currently the President of Marylebone Cricket Club (MCC) was quoted as saying in the media release of the Royals.
Sanju Samson, the newly appointed skipper of the Royals was excited to have the Sri Lankan who played 594 international matches and scored more than 28,000 runs, as the Director of Cricket.
"It's great to have an all-time wicketkeeping great with us, he is someone who's donned many hats, he was a fantastic keeper-batsman. He's someone who's shown great character both on and off the field and the values that one associate with him is the same which we embody here at Rajasthan Royals," said the Kerala captain.
